The Impact of Temperature on Paint Application
When you're preparing an industrial outside painting task, the temperature can considerably impact how well the paint sticks and dries out.
Ideally, you want to repaint when temperature levels range in between 50 ° F and 85 ° F. If it's also cool, the paint may not heal correctly, resulting in problems like peeling off or cracking.
On the other hand, if it's too warm, the paint can dry also promptly, avoiding appropriate attachment and causing an uneven surface.
You ought to likewise take into consideration the time of day; early morning or late afternoon offers cooler temperature levels, which can be a lot more beneficial.
Constantly inspect the producer's recommendations for the details paint you're utilizing, as they often offer support on the optimal temperature level array for optimum outcomes.
Moisture and Its Impact on Drying Times
Temperature level isn't the only ecological aspect that affects your business outside paint task; humidity plays a considerable function also. High moisture degrees can reduce drying times drastically, influencing the overall high quality of your paint work.
When the air is filled with wetness, the paint takes longer to heal, which can lead to concerns like bad adhesion and a greater threat of mold development. If you're repainting on a particularly humid day, be prepared for extensive wait times between coats.
It's vital to monitor local weather conditions and plan as necessary. Ideally, aim for humidity degrees between 40% and 70% for optimum drying.
Maintaining these factors in mind guarantees your project stays on track and provides a long-term coating.
